SLYV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2025 in Review
584 of the 8,266 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in State Street SPDR S&P 600 Small Cap Value ETF (SLYV) for Q4 2025, worth a combined $2.73B — up 0.82% from $2.71B a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 66 funds opened new SLYV positions and 38 closed out — a net gain of 28 holders — while 179 added to existing stakes and 242 trimmed.
The largest buyer was WCG Wealth Advisors, adding an estimated $21.4M. The largest seller was Bank of America, cutting an estimated $81.2M.
